The 41st Hong Kong International Jewellery Show and the 11th Hong Kong International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show attracted nearly 4,000 exhibitors from over 40 countries and regions, held in a “two shows, two venues” format.
The Jewellery Show wrapped up at the Hong Kong Convention and Exhibition Centre (HKCEC) on March 8, while the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show concluded at AsiaWorld-Expo near Hong Kong International Airport on March 6.
This year’s event introduced the Gold Jewellery zone, featuring exceptional designs and finely crafted gold jewellery, along with the Young Jewellery Designer Arena, which spotlighted emerging designers and their potential in seizing new market opportunities.
Sophia Chong, Deputy Executive Director of the Hong Kong Trade Development Council (HKTDC), commented: “As a key global trading hub for the jewellery industry, these twin jewellery shows brought together international buyers and hosted over 30 industry seminars and activities, promoting innovation and collaboration within the sector.”
